Joel Spolsky observes that Microsoft bought out the company that makes the best search add-on for Outlook not to improve searching in Outlook, but rather to improve MSN’s search engine. They’re killing the search add-on that everybody seemed to love effective immediately.

So, Joel has updated, and Anil mentions that the searching component in Lookout was actually Jakarta Lucene, an open source text search component. So who knows why Microsoft bought Lookout?
